How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 35209?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 35209 Studio Apartments | $1,006 | $625 | $2,099 |
| 35209 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,227 | $325 | $2,240 |
| 35209 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,504 | $620 | $4,444 |
| 35209 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,808 | $1,188 | $3,333 |
| 35209 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,789 | $2,689 | $2,889 |
